Relaciones intermediales entre música y cine

Camen Amaya en la pantalla del periodo republicano
Authors: GARCÍA-DEFEZ, OLGA;

Relaciones intermediales entre música y cine

Abstract

La nómina de actrices del cine sonoro producido hasta el comienzo de la Guerra Civil se configuró con la adición de figuras de la propia cinematografía, provenientes del teatro y del medio musical. Un caso relevante de esta tercera opción lo constituye la bailaora Carmen Amaya, quien comenzó a participar en el cine con pequeñas intervenciones hasta llegar a protagonizar la película María de la O (Francisco Elías, 1939). Dichas intervenciones presentan una serie de características que distinguen a la bailaora del resto del star system de la época.
